So what _is_ "QSK" anyway?  With 1.370 and the internal keyer, I did a 
little test.  Set sidetone to zero and sent (tx disabled!) a steady 
stream of dashes or dots.  Above about 20 wpm, the T/R switch never 
drops and you hear nothing off the air.  As you go below 20 wpm, you do 
hear a little between dots or dashes.  [That's a lot less than .25 sec, 
by the way.]

What we have now is a little Rx between characters and more between 
words.  Is that QSK? I suppose to purists, you should get Rx any time 
there is no RF out, i.e., between elements.

Actually, I like it this way, since there's less pulsing in my headset 
while sending.
